Transaction 3d07306e8a009cfa4de67a1177cba330d36afee1169bab381d6ac909c282c414
1 Input
1 Output
-
3d07306e8a009cfa4de67a1177cba330d36afee1169bab381d6ac909c282c414:0
- value
- 21124351
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70d865a8af034367ab7e8e18e69758b76df060c6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BHfv28UfQv4RHPYULUd3WmFnynNGUDoCm